From CNN an hour ago: "Israeli forces are now operating freely in Tehran’s airspace, after eliminating many of Iran’s air defense systems, an Israel Defense Forces (IDF) official has said. “We’ve established aerial freedom of action from western Iran to Tehran,” IDF spokesperson Brig. Gen. Effie Defrin said in a briefing on Saturday. “Our Air Force pilots flew for about two and a half hours over Tehran, alongside UAVs that remain airborne 24/7, surveilling the area and concluding with attacks and intelligence gathering,” the spokesperson added. That aerial superiority enabled Israel to launch surprise attacks on Iran, and to “act and thwart threats to Israel,” Defrin said. The official also said more than 70 Israeli jet fighters struck 40 targets in and around the Iranian capital overnight. “This is the first time we’ve operated in this airspace,” Defrin said, adding that it is the deepest penetration into Iran to date. “Dozens of these aircraft now operate freely over Tehran, thanks to our opening strikes, which eliminated many Iranian air defense threats,” he added."
